На моем сервере Ubuntu использование диска показывает, что мой /dev/xvda1 используется для 100%. Каков наилучший способ поиска наиболее объемных файлов?
Это даст вам топ-10:
du -hsx * | sort -rh | head -10
du - использование диска -h для чтения человеком -s summary -x skip directories sort, -r, чтобы отменить результат. -h человекочитаемые числа. head: показать первые 10 строк. Если вы хотите получить больше / меньше результатов, измените номер. Вы можете установить использование дискового пространства NCurses:
ncdu (использование дисков NCurses) - это версия известного «du» на основе curses и обеспечивает быстрый способ увидеть, какие каталоги используют ваши дисковое пространство.Он доступен в репозитории юниверса.
Установите ncdu следующей командой:
sudo apt-get install ncdu
Затем запустите ncdu, и вы получите выход, как следующее:
Вы также можете указать путь к каталогу:
ncdu <path/to/dir>
Также полезные параметры, такие как:
ncdu (использование дискового пространства NCurses) - это проклятая версия известного «du» и обеспечивает быстрый способ увидеть, какие каталоги используют ваше дисковое пространство.
- q Тихий режим. При сканировании или импортировании каталога ncdu по умолчанию обновит экран 10 раз в секунду, это будет уменьшено до одного раза в 2 секунды в тихом режиме. Используйте эту функцию для экономии полосы пропускания через удаленные подключения.